Digital Signal Processing (DSP) is a game-changer in electrical systems. It's like having a super-smart brain that can clean up messy signals, analyze complex data, and make our gadgets work better. From making phone calls clearer to helping doctors see inside our bodies, DSP is everywhere.

In this part, we'll check out how DSP tackles real-world problems. We'll see how it cuts out noise, breaks down signals into their parts, and jazzes up audio and images. We'll also explore how it keeps machines in check and helps us communicate better.

Signal Processing Applications

Noise Reduction and Signal Enhancement Techniques

Top images from around the web for Noise Reduction and Signal Enhancement Techniques
Top images from around the web for Noise Reduction and Signal Enhancement Techniques
  • removes unwanted interference from signals
    • Employs to isolate desired frequencies
    • adjusts parameters based on input characteristics
    • subtracts estimated noise spectrum from signal
  • amplifies or clarifies desired signal components
    • boosts specific frequency ranges (bass, treble)
    • reduces volume differences between loud and soft sounds
    • reverses distortions caused by transmission channels
  • Applications include improving audio quality in telecommunications and enhancing medical imaging clarity

Spectrum Analysis Methods

  • examines signal composition in frequency domain
  • (FFT) efficiently converts time-domain signals to frequency domain
    • Reveals frequency components and their relative strengths
    • Enables identification of periodic patterns and harmonics
  • (PSD) estimates signal power distribution across frequencies
    • Useful for identifying dominant frequency components
    • Helps characterize random signals and noise
  • displays how frequency content changes over time
    • Creates visual representation of spectrum evolution
    • Valuable for analyzing non-stationary signals (speech, music)

Audio and Image Processing Techniques

  • manipulates sound signals for various purposes
    • reduces file size while maintaining quality (MP3, AAC)
    • adds reverb, echo, or pitch shifting
    • extracts linguistic content from audio
  • enhances or analyzes visual information
    • Filtering removes noise or enhances edges
    • divides image into meaningful regions
    • identifies key characteristics (corners, textures)
    • Compression reduces file size (JPEG, PNG)
  • Both audio and image processing utilize similar DSP concepts
    • Filtering, transform-based analysis, and compression techniques
    • Adaptation of algorithms to 1D (audio) or 2D (image) data

Control and Communication Systems

Digital Control Systems

  • use DSP to regulate processes or devices
  • Discrete-time controllers implement control algorithms
    • PID (Proportional-Integral-Derivative) control adjusts system response
    • manages complex multi-input, multi-output systems
  • Digital filters process sensor inputs and generate control outputs
    • FIR (Finite Impulse Response) filters provide linear phase response
    • IIR (Infinite Impulse Response) filters offer efficient computation
  • Applications include industrial automation, robotics, and vehicle control systems
    • Precise motor control in manufacturing
    • Stability control in aircraft and automobiles

Digital Communication Systems

  • transmit information using DSP techniques
  • encodes digital data onto carrier signals
    • ASK () varies signal amplitude
    • FSK () alters signal frequency
    • PSK () changes signal phase
    • QAM () combines amplitude and phase modulation
  • improve transmission reliability
    • detect and correct single-bit errors
    • handle burst errors in data blocks
  • Equalization compensates for channel distortions
    • adjust to changing channel conditions
    • Decision feedback equalizers use previous decisions to improve performance
  • Applications span wireless networks, satellite communications, and fiber optic systems

Biomedical Signal Processing

Analysis and Interpretation of Physiological Signals

  • extracts information from biological systems
  • ECG (Electrocardiogram) analysis assesses heart function
    • QRS complex detection identifies individual heartbeats
    • Heart rate variability analysis examines beat-to-beat variations
  • EEG (Electroencephalogram) processing studies brain activity
    • Spectral analysis identifies different brain wave patterns (alpha, beta, theta)
    • Event-related potential analysis examines responses to specific stimuli
  • EMG (Electromyogram) analysis evaluates muscle activity
    • Onset detection determines muscle activation timing
    • Frequency analysis assesses muscle fatigue

Medical Imaging and Diagnostic Techniques

  • Medical imaging processes use DSP to create and enhance visual representations
  • CT (Computed Tomography) reconstruction algorithms create 3D images from X-ray projections
    • provides fast image reconstruction
    • Iterative reconstruction improves image quality with reduced radiation dose
  • MRI (Magnetic Resonance Imaging) processing generates detailed soft tissue images
    • Fourier transform converts raw data into spatial images
    • Pulse sequence optimization enhances tissue contrast
  • Ultrasound imaging processes reflected sound waves
    • Beamforming focuses ultrasound energy for improved resolution
    • measures blood flow velocities
  • Image enhancement techniques improve diagnostic accuracy
    • Noise reduction removes artifacts and improves clarity
    • Contrast enhancement highlights specific features or abnormalities

Key Terms to Review (44)

Adaptive equalizers: Adaptive equalizers are advanced signal processing devices that automatically adjust their parameters to compensate for distortion in communication channels, ensuring that the received signal closely matches the transmitted signal. They play a vital role in improving data integrity and minimizing error rates, making them essential in modern communication systems that rely on digital signal processing techniques.
Adaptive Filtering: Adaptive filtering is a signal processing technique that automatically adjusts its parameters to minimize the difference between the desired output and the actual output. This adaptability makes it particularly useful in various applications where the signal characteristics or noise levels may change over time, allowing the filter to maintain optimal performance under varying conditions.
Amplitude Shift Keying: Amplitude Shift Keying (ASK) is a modulation technique used in digital communication where the amplitude of a carrier signal is varied in accordance with the digital data being transmitted. This method enables the representation of binary data, with different amplitude levels signifying different binary values, typically '0' and '1'. ASK is significant in applications that require efficient data transmission over various media, especially where bandwidth is a critical factor.
Audio processing: Audio processing refers to the manipulation and transformation of audio signals to enhance or modify sound quality and characteristics. This process can involve filtering, equalization, dynamic range compression, and effects such as reverb or echo, which are essential in various applications from music production to telecommunications.
Beamforming in ultrasound imaging: Beamforming in ultrasound imaging is a signal processing technique that focuses the emitted sound waves in a specific direction to enhance the quality and resolution of the resulting images. This method optimizes the reception of echoes from targeted areas, allowing for clearer and more accurate visualization of internal structures, which is crucial for medical diagnostics.
Biomedical signal processing: Biomedical signal processing is the application of digital signal processing techniques to analyze, interpret, and manipulate biological signals. These signals can come from various medical instruments and include vital signs like ECG, EEG, and EMG. This field plays a crucial role in improving diagnostic accuracy and enhancing the understanding of physiological processes.
Compression: Compression refers to the process of reducing the amount of data required to represent a signal or information. This technique is vital in various electrical systems, particularly in digital signal processing (DSP), as it allows for efficient storage and transmission of data while maintaining the quality of the original signal.
Ct reconstruction algorithms: CT reconstruction algorithms are computational methods used to create images of the internal structures of an object from a series of X-ray projections taken at different angles. These algorithms process the data acquired from the CT scanner and apply mathematical techniques to reconstruct a three-dimensional representation, enhancing image quality and providing essential information for diagnostic purposes in medical imaging and industrial applications.
Deconvolution: Deconvolution is a mathematical process used to reverse the effects of convolution on a signal, essentially recovering the original signal from its convolved version. This process is crucial in various applications, as it allows for improved signal clarity and analysis, which is particularly beneficial in fields like communications and imaging. By applying deconvolution techniques, one can effectively separate mixed signals or improve the resolution of data obtained from systems that have altered the original signals.
Digital communication systems: Digital communication systems refer to the technologies and processes involved in transmitting and receiving data in digital form over various channels. These systems utilize discrete signals to encode information, allowing for more efficient and reliable transmission compared to analog methods. By leveraging techniques such as modulation, error correction, and signal processing, digital communication systems enhance data integrity and security in a variety of applications.
Digital control systems: Digital control systems are systems that use digital computers or microcontrollers to perform control functions on dynamic systems. They process input signals, implement control algorithms, and generate output signals to manipulate the behavior of physical processes. This approach allows for precise control, flexibility, and the ability to handle complex algorithms that may be difficult to achieve with analog systems.
Digital filters: Digital filters are mathematical algorithms or processes used to manipulate discrete signals by removing unwanted components or enhancing desired ones. They play a crucial role in digital signal processing (DSP) and are widely used in various applications to improve signal quality, reduce noise, and extract useful information from the data.
Doppler Processing: Doppler processing is a technique used in signal processing to analyze the frequency shifts of signals due to the relative motion between a source and an observer. This concept is crucial in various applications, such as radar and communications, where it helps to detect and measure the speed of moving objects. By leveraging the Doppler effect, systems can extract vital information about target velocity and direction, making it essential for accurate tracking and imaging in electrical systems.
Dynamic range compression: Dynamic range compression is a signal processing technique used to reduce the difference between the loudest and softest parts of an audio signal. This technique helps maintain a consistent sound level, making it easier to hear details in quieter passages while preventing distortion in louder sections. Dynamic range compression plays a vital role in various applications, particularly in enhancing audio quality and intelligibility in electrical systems.
ECG analysis: ECG analysis refers to the systematic examination of electrocardiogram (ECG) data, which records the electrical activity of the heart over time. This analysis is crucial for diagnosing various cardiac conditions and monitoring heart health, allowing healthcare professionals to interpret complex patterns and detect abnormalities in heart rhythm, rate, and overall function.
Eeg processing: EEG processing refers to the analysis of electroencephalogram data, which records electrical activity in the brain using electrodes placed on the scalp. This process involves filtering, segmenting, and interpreting brain wave patterns to identify neurological conditions, monitor brain states, or facilitate brain-computer interface applications. EEG processing is crucial for understanding brain function and developing therapies in various medical fields.
Effects processing: Effects processing refers to the manipulation and alteration of audio signals through digital signal processing (DSP) techniques to create various sound effects. This includes enhancing audio quality, adding depth, and introducing new sonic characteristics that transform the original sound into something unique and expressive. By employing effects processing, engineers can achieve a wide range of auditory experiences, making it essential in modern electrical systems.
Emg analysis: EMG analysis refers to the evaluation of electromyographic signals that are produced by muscle electrical activity. This technique is widely used in various applications, such as medical diagnostics, rehabilitation, and sports science, to assess muscle function and health. By interpreting the signals obtained from muscle contractions, EMG analysis helps in understanding neuromuscular diseases, monitoring muscle performance, and developing biofeedback systems for enhanced motor control.
Equalization: Equalization is a signal processing technique used to adjust the balance between frequency components within a signal. This process helps in compensating for distortions or losses that occur during transmission, ensuring that the received signal closely resembles the original. By manipulating frequency responses, equalization enhances the quality and intelligibility of signals in various electrical systems.
Error Correction Codes: Error correction codes (ECC) are methods used in digital communications and data storage to detect and correct errors that may occur during data transmission or retrieval. These codes enhance the reliability of data by allowing the original information to be reconstructed even when some bits are corrupted, which is crucial in applications like data transmission over noisy channels and storage devices.
Fast Fourier Transform: The Fast Fourier Transform (FFT) is an algorithm that efficiently computes the Discrete Fourier Transform (DFT) and its inverse. It breaks down a complex signal into its constituent frequencies, making it essential for analyzing the frequency components of signals in various electrical systems and digital signal processing applications.
Feature Extraction: Feature extraction is the process of transforming raw data into a set of measurable properties or characteristics that can be used for analysis or classification. This method helps in reducing the complexity of the data while retaining essential information, making it easier to identify patterns and make decisions based on the processed signals in electrical systems.
Filtered back projection: Filtered back projection is an image reconstruction technique used primarily in computed tomography (CT) and other imaging systems to convert raw data into a recognizable image. This method applies a mathematical filter to the projection data before reconstructing the image, improving the clarity and detail of the final output. The filtering process helps to reduce noise and artifacts that can obscure important features in the image.
FIR Filters: Finite Impulse Response (FIR) filters are a type of digital filter characterized by a finite duration of the impulse response, which means they only respond to inputs for a limited period of time. They are commonly used in digital signal processing applications due to their inherent stability and the ease with which they can be designed using methods like the windowing technique or frequency sampling method. FIR filters play a crucial role in shaping signals, removing unwanted frequencies, and enhancing desired components in electrical systems.
Fourier Transform in MRI: The Fourier Transform in MRI is a mathematical technique used to convert data from the frequency domain to the spatial domain, allowing for the reconstruction of images from raw MRI signals. This process is essential for translating the complex signals obtained during an MRI scan into clear and interpretable images of the body's internal structures. By breaking down signals into their constituent frequencies, it provides a powerful tool for enhancing image quality and enabling detailed analysis of anatomical features.
Frequency shift keying: Frequency Shift Keying (FSK) is a method of digital communication that uses discrete frequencies to represent digital data. In FSK, different frequencies correspond to different binary values, allowing for efficient transmission of information over various communication channels, especially in the realm of electrical systems. This technique is commonly employed in applications requiring reliable data transmission, making it vital in modern electrical system designs.
Hamming Codes: Hamming codes are a set of error-correcting codes that can detect and correct single-bit errors in data transmission or storage. Developed by Richard Hamming, these codes add redundant bits to the original data, allowing the receiver to identify and correct errors without needing to resend the data. This capability is essential in ensuring data integrity and reliability in digital communications and computing systems.
IIR Filters: IIR filters, or Infinite Impulse Response filters, are a type of digital filter characterized by their feedback mechanism that allows for an infinite duration of impulse response. They use past output values in their calculations, which means they can achieve desired filter characteristics with fewer coefficients compared to their FIR counterparts, making them efficient in terms of computation and memory usage. This efficiency makes IIR filters widely applicable in various digital signal processing tasks, particularly in electrical systems where performance and resource constraints are important.
Image Processing: Image processing refers to the manipulation and analysis of digital images using various algorithms and techniques to enhance, transform, or extract information from the images. This field utilizes mathematical and computational methods to improve image quality, extract meaningful features, and enable applications such as recognition and classification in electrical systems.
Modulation: Modulation is the process of varying a carrier signal's properties, such as its amplitude, frequency, or phase, to encode information for transmission. This technique enables the efficient use of the available bandwidth and improves signal resilience against noise and interference during transmission in electrical systems.
MRI Processing: MRI processing refers to the techniques and methods used to convert raw data obtained from magnetic resonance imaging into meaningful images that can be analyzed by medical professionals. This involves a series of digital signal processing (DSP) steps, including filtering, reconstruction, and enhancement, to produce high-quality images that aid in diagnosing various medical conditions.
Noise reduction: Noise reduction refers to the techniques and methods used to minimize unwanted disturbances or signals in electronic systems, allowing for clearer and more accurate signal processing. This concept is crucial for enhancing the performance of various applications, especially in filtering unwanted frequencies and improving the quality of transmitted information. By applying noise reduction strategies, engineers can ensure that essential signals are preserved while minimizing the impact of noise on system performance.
Phase Shift Keying: Phase Shift Keying (PSK) is a digital modulation technique that conveys data by varying the phase of a carrier wave. This method allows for the transmission of binary data over a communication channel, making it efficient and reliable, particularly in the context of digital signal processing applications in electrical systems.
Pid control: PID control stands for Proportional-Integral-Derivative control, a widely used feedback control loop mechanism that aims to maintain a desired output by adjusting the control inputs. It combines three strategies: proportional control, which responds to the current error; integral control, which considers the accumulation of past errors; and derivative control, which predicts future errors based on their rate of change. This combination allows PID controllers to effectively handle various dynamic systems in engineering and electrical applications.
Power Spectral Density: Power spectral density (PSD) is a measure that describes how the power of a signal is distributed across different frequency components. It provides insights into the frequency characteristics of signals, which is crucial for analyzing and processing signals in various electrical systems, enabling efficient design and optimization in applications like communications and signal processing.
Quadrature Amplitude Modulation: Quadrature amplitude modulation (QAM) is a modulation scheme that conveys data by changing the amplitude of two carrier waves, which are out of phase by 90 degrees. It combines both amplitude modulation and phase modulation, allowing the transmission of more bits per symbol compared to other methods. This makes QAM particularly useful in digital communication systems, where bandwidth efficiency is crucial.
Reed-Solomon Codes: Reed-Solomon codes are a type of error-correcting code used to detect and correct errors in data transmission and storage. They are particularly effective in correcting burst errors, which occur when multiple adjacent symbols are altered. These codes work by adding redundant data, enabling the receiver to reconstruct the original data even if parts of it are corrupted, making them vital in digital communication systems.
Segmentation: Segmentation refers to the process of dividing a signal into smaller, more manageable parts for analysis, processing, or enhancement. This concept is crucial in digital signal processing (DSP) as it allows for more efficient handling of data, enabling targeted manipulation and improved performance in various applications such as filtering and noise reduction.
Signal enhancement: Signal enhancement refers to the process of improving the quality and clarity of a signal, making it easier to analyze and interpret. This can involve increasing the signal-to-noise ratio, reducing distortion, and removing unwanted artifacts, ultimately leading to a more accurate representation of the original information. Effective signal enhancement is crucial in various applications where signals may be weak or corrupted.
Spectral subtraction: Spectral subtraction is a technique used in digital signal processing to reduce noise from a signal by estimating the noise spectrum and subtracting it from the noisy signal spectrum. This method is particularly effective in improving the quality of audio signals by enhancing the desired components while minimizing unwanted noise. It relies on analyzing the frequency domain representation of a signal, making it applicable in various scenarios, especially in the context of electrical systems that utilize DSP techniques.
Spectrogram: A spectrogram is a visual representation of the spectrum of frequencies in a signal as it varies with time. It provides insights into the frequency content of a signal and helps analyze its characteristics by displaying the amplitude or power of each frequency component over a specified time frame.
Spectrum analysis: Spectrum analysis is a technique used to identify the frequency components of a signal by decomposing it into its constituent frequencies. This method helps in understanding how different frequency components contribute to the overall signal, providing insights into the signal's characteristics, such as amplitude and phase relationships. It plays a critical role in various applications within electrical systems, especially when using digital signal processing techniques.
Speech recognition: Speech recognition is a technology that enables a computer or device to identify and process human speech into a format that can be understood and acted upon. This involves converting spoken language into text and facilitating various applications, from voice commands to transcription services, significantly impacting how we interact with technology.
State-space control: State-space control is a mathematical framework used in control theory that represents a physical system by a set of input, output, and state variables related by first-order differential equations. This approach allows for modeling and analyzing systems in multiple dimensions, capturing the dynamics of the system more comprehensively compared to traditional methods. It plays a significant role in modern control applications, particularly in the context of digital signal processing (DSP) within electrical systems.
© 2024 Fiveable Inc. All rights reserved.
AP® and SAT® are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.